Bitcoin bear market ‘in final stages,’ as this analyst eyes $180,000 BTC in 2027
Early August brought renewed optimism across the cryptocurrency sector, and one popular on-chain analyst, Ali Martinez, believes that the Bitcoin ($BTC) bear market might be ‘in final stages.’
Specifically, in an X post published on August 11, the blockchain expert appears to have mapped a trajectory that could take $BTC 181% higher from $63,874 at press time to at least $180,000 by the second half (H2) of 2027.
Martinez appears to have drawn a direct comparison between what he now expects of Bitcoin and the cryptocurrency’s trajectory between the 2023 bullish reversal and the most recent all-time high (ATH) above $125,000 reached in late 2025.
Furthermore, the on-chain analyst appears to have also leaned on a series of technical buy signals he identified on August 7.

Why this on-chain analyst believes Bitcoin bull market will restart in 2026
Indeed, last Friday, Ali Martinez explained that there was an apparent convergence of indicators hinting at a significant incoming Bitcoin price rally.
To begin with, the expert stated that TD Sequential – a technical analysis tool developed late in the previous century and designed to identify a trend reversal – appeared in the July chart. The very same signal, the analyst added, appeared in 2022 and correctly detected the market bottom.
Another indicator that Bitcoin was nearing the bottom of the current bear market, Martinez stated, came in the form of $BTC price approaching its 50-month simple moving average (SMA) – another phenomenon that historically tended to coincide with cycle lows.
Finally, the blockchain analyst posted that the Chande Momentum Oscillator reset to -71. A similar signal flashed in June when the world’s premier cryptocurrency plummeted toward $57,000, further strengthening the notion that a market bottom is near.

Still, Ali Martinez warned that Bitcoin could still consolidate between $60,000 and $67,000 rather than soaring – and, indeed, the expert noted on multiple occasions in 2026 that the $BTC bottom is likely in early October – though he emphasized that technical analysis strongly hints at a rally.
2026 Bitcoin price chart
Meanwhile, Bitcoin has been trading with significant volatility within the last 30 days, though its price – with a 0.36% monthly decline – remained ultimately flat within the timeframe.

Nonetheless, the fact that the world’s premier cryptocurrency remains 26.93% in the red year-to-date (YTD) and that it has been keeping a relatively steady price since early June does lend credence to the notion that the market is in an accumulation phase ahead of an explosive rally.
